EL ETERNO PRESENTE

My first ever virtual exhibition.

I believe art can help change the world by helping us communicate past words, and connecting us through a deeper, more powerful part of ourselves. That’s why I want to create spaces that allow us to have that, to immerse ourselves into art in new ways that can still have an impact, and transform us in ways like a direct experience could.

El Eterno Presente was my first exhibition ever, it’s composed of 10 pieces I made in 2022 that were displayed through September of that year.
